Black Butterflies

Synopsis : Tanit migrates with her children from the dry, uninhabitable region of Turkana to Nairobi. In India, Shaila leaves her small island of Ghoramara, which is shrinking due to rising sea levels, to work as a housekeeper in Dubai. And Valeria flies with her children to Paris after a hurricane destabilizes life on the French island of Saint Martin. All three women are hoping for a better life, but in their new environments are forced to deal with various forms of exploitation. Focusing on climate refugees who have lost everything due to global warming, Black Butterflies is a radical and affecting call for change.

David Baute

David Baute is currently the artistic director of the MiradasDoc Documentary Film Festival. His films –Ella(s) (2010), La murga, opera popular (2014), Milagros (2018), and Climate Exodus (2020)– have been selected in various national and international festivals.
